Faith Christian Fellowship Academy
Faith Christian Fellowship Academy serves 91 students in grades Kindergarten-9, is a member of the Association of Christian Schools International (ACSI).
The student:teacher of Faith Christian Fellowship Academy is 8:1 and the school's religious affiliation is Christian.
